首页 > 数据库 >9月《中国数据库行业分析报告》已发布,47页干货带你详览 MySQL 崛起之路!

9月《中国数据库行业分析报告》已发布,47页干货带你详览 MySQL 崛起之路!

时间:2023-10-10 13:23:52浏览次数:55  
标签:报告 47 数据库 天轮 开源 2022 MySQL 详览

为了帮助大家及时了解中国数据库行业发展现状、梳理当前数据库市场环境和产品生态等情况,从2022年4月起,墨天轮社区行业分析研究团队出品将持续每月为大家推出最新中国数据库行业分析报告持续传播数据技术知识、努力促进技术创新与行业生态发展,目前已更至第十七期,并发布了共计122页的2022年度分析报告

 

墨天轮9月《中国数据库行业分析报告》已正式发布(点击即可跳转,欢迎大家下载查阅),本期报盘点了墨天轮“中国数据库流行度排行”、新品发布、投融资等业内资讯,以此展现当前数据库市场发展前沿动态。

 

根据6sense网站2023年统计数据,在全球关系型数据库市场中,MySQL市场份额最高,达到42.12%,本次便聚焦于此,从MySQL数据库管理系统崛起与演变历程讲起,介绍其现状与未来发展,报告最后详细盘点了国内以GreatSQL、PolarDB-X、StoneDB、TXSQL、AliSQL等为代表的国内开源数据库的生态建设。

 

一、数据库排行榜及前沿动态

本章节分析了2023年9月中国数据库流行度榜单,并盘点中国数据库及数仓软件市场。在行业发展方向,报告整理了8-9月的数据库版本发布以及融资等动态。此处因篇幅仅展现部分,具体内容可查阅报告

 

  • 9月中国数据库流行度排名分析

 

2023年9月的墨天轮中国数据库流行度排行火热出炉,本月共有287个数据库参与排名。中国数据库行业头部竞争日益激烈,尤其是本月排行榜第三名 TiDB 与华为云 GaussDB 之间的分差仅有1.29分,本月排行榜前五中,阿里云PolarDB 深耕云端、热度攀升登榜眼,华为云GaussDB 排名连续上升。第6名至第10名,凭借深厚积淀维持上月排名,汇聚生态、产品等各方优势,在墨天轮排行榜占据优势地位。

 

 

在排行榜前40名的赛段中,拓数派 PieCloudDB,TGDB 力争上游。此外,还有一些数据库产品深耕细作,表现亮眼。

 

  • 中国数据库及数仓软件市场最新盘点

 

从2023年1月至9月,中国数据库排行榜收录的数据库数量基本呈现稳步增长的态势。2023年1月墨天轮共收录256个中国数据库产品,最新收录数相比1月增加了31个产品,图、时序、搜索等数据库细分赛道的产品队伍也日益扩大。

 

IDC《2022年下半年中国数据仓库软件市场跟踪报告》显示,2022年中国数据仓库软件市场规模为8.7亿美元,同比增长23.7%。IDC预测, 到2027年,中国数据仓库软件市场规模将达到27.3亿美元,2022-2027的5年市场年复合增长率(CAGR)为25.7%。

 

 

  • 数据库行业发展动态

 

报告整理了近期业内较受关注的投融资、新品发布等资讯。数据分析和人工智能软件制造商Databricks已筹集了价值超过5亿美元的第一轮融资,估值达到430亿美元;实时索引数据库厂商Rockset 完成 4400 万美元B+轮融资,融资规模扩大至 1.05 亿美元。

 

版本发布方向,随着Apache Doris 2.0.0 版本在8月发布,目前已有超过 275 位贡献者为 Apache Doris 提交了超过 4100 个优化与修复;9月14日,PostgreSQL 全球开发集团宣布发布 PostgreSQL 16,这是世界上最先进的开源数据库的最新版本;于此同时,Redis, Inc.宣布在公司所有产品和服务中统一发布 Redis 7.2,包括开源、可用源、商业云、软件和Kubernetes发行版。

二、MySQL 概况与演变历程

本章节介绍了 MySQL 数据库的诞生背景、发展历程,并详细展示了其各版本以及衍生版本。此外,随着MySQL 存储引擎、查询优化器、索引以及中间件的发展优化,产品性能不断提升。因篇幅仅展现部分,具体内容可查阅报告

 

  • MySQL 发展历程

 

MySQL 是一个开源关系型数据库管理系统,其主要通过表结构来存储数据,每一个列称为一个字段,每一行称为一个记录,每一个列的集合称为数据表,每一个表的集合称为数据库。其最初由 Monty Widenius 和 Axmark 于 1994 年开始开发。

 

 

  • MySQL 版本介绍

 

1995年5月23日,MySQL 首次内部发布。1996年底,MySQL 3.19 正式发布。2001年1月22日,MySQL 3.23发布,其是 MySQL 系列的早期版本,为开发人员提供了一个稳定的开源数据库系统。目前,MySQL 8.1 已经于2023年7月18日正式发行。从此,MySQL 将开启创新版和稳定版同时发行的阶段,MySQL 8.1是 MySQL 的首个创新版。如今,MySQL 是使用最广泛的开源关系数据库系统。

 

 

  • MySQL 技术架构及演进

 

MySQL的架构自顶向下大致可以分为网络连接层、数据库服务层、存储引擎层和系统文件层四大部分。业务飞速发展导致数据规模急速膨胀,单机的数据库已经无法满足互联网业务的发展。MySQL 技术架构在新技术的引领下持续演进,从单机到云原生RDS+HeatWave ,产品性能不断提升。

 

报告中详细介绍了 MySQL 存储引擎、查询优化器、索引以及中间件的发展优化

 

 

 

 

 

  • 中国基于MySQL 开发的数据库

 

随着技术发展与不断打磨,国产数据库领域取得了长足的进步,其中一项引人注目的成就是自主研发的MySQL衍生数据库。以下展现了中国基于MySQL 开发的数据库。

三、MySQL 现状及未来发展

本章节介绍了 MySQL 数据库的发展现状以及未来的机遇挑战,并展现了部分客户案例。因篇幅仅展现部分,具体内容可查阅报告

 

  • MySQL 发展现状

 

MySQL⼀直是全球最流行的开源数据库之一,拥有广泛的受众。在DB-Engines流行度排名中,MySQL已连续数年位于流行度前两位。同时报告基于多份国内外研究报告的数据,以此多方位展示出MySQL 的流行度以及市场份额占比,和中国数据库社区的生态建设现状,目前MySQL 已成为使用最广泛的开源关系数据库系统。

 

  • MySQL 未来与挑战

 

随着数据量的增加,MySQL 数据库需要更好的性能扩展和高可用性解决方案,以应对大规模流量和故障。此外,数据的价值在现代社会变得日益重要,恶意攻击或人为错误可能导致数据泄露,因此需要强化的安全措施,如身份验证、授权和审计。在新的技术背景下,MySQL 未来会朝着云、数据安全、HTAP等方向发展。

四、中国数据库产品典型案例

报告最后一章选取了国内部分数据库作为典型案例,并介绍了核心架构、版本特性以及产品形态等,可对标MySQL,实现数据库国产化落地。

 

作为阿里云自主研发的原生 MySQL 分布式数据库,PolarDB-X 兼容 MySQL 协议与客户端,具备自动负载均衡、高可用、HTAP 混合负载、支持分布式事务、全局二级索引等重要特性;GreatSQL是源于Percona Server的分支版本,进一步提升了MGR(MySQL Group Replication)的性能及可靠性,以及众多bug修复;SUNDB拥有完整的知识产权并完全掌握国际一流的数据库根技术,内核完全自主研发;TXSQL 是腾讯云数据库团队自研 MySQL 内核分支,100%兼容原生 MySQL 版本,针对企业级的重要场景,自研众多核心特性;GoldenDB 采用DBPROXY+MYSQL数据库的存算分离的架构,计算节点是一组DBPROXY,负责SQL分发与聚合计算工作,数据都存储在存储节点中,GoldenDB的存储节点支持NO-SHARDING模式的主从数据库和SHARDING数据库集群两种类型;StoneDB 是国内首款开源的 MySQL HTAP数据库,具备行列混存、智能索引等核心特性。

 

报告最后还展现了由星环科技打造的分布式关系型数据库 KunDB 平滑迁移的实践。

 

 

 

 

本文仅对9月《中国数据库行业分析报告》的部分内容进行了摘录、整理,更多完整、详细内容大家可以下载报告全文了解,也欢迎各位数据行业同道交流、讨论、建言献策,我们一同见证、共同助力中国数据库产业的发展壮大!

 

报告全文下载地址:(https://www.modb.pro/doc/118413

往期报告下载

 

更多精彩内容尽在墨天轮数据社区,围绕数据人的学习成长提供一站式的全面服务,持续促进数据领域的知识传播和技术创新。添加社区墨天轮小助手(VX:modb666)可获取更多技术干货。

标签:报告,47,数据库,天轮,开源,2022,MySQL,详览
From: https://www.cnblogs.com/modb/p/17754420.html

相关文章

  • MySQL进阶篇:第三章_SQL性能分析
    MySQL进阶篇:第三章_SQL性能分析SQL执行频率MySQL客户端连接成功后,通过show[session|global]status命令可以提供服务器状态信息。通过如下指令,可以查看当前数据库的INSERT、UPDATE、DELETE、SELECT的访问频次:--session是查看当前会话;--global是查询全局数据;SHOW......
  • 定时备份mysql脚本
    定时备份mysql指定数据库脚本,保留60天#!/bin/bash#pathcd/opt/pmo/mysql_datatarget_directory="/opt/pmo/mysql_data"#gettimenowcurrent_time=$(date+%s)#cal22monthsagobefore_time=$(date-d"60daysago"+%s)file_name=metersphere_`date+......
  • MySQL进阶篇:第四章_四.一_ 索引使用_最左前缀法则
    索引使用_最左前缀法则最左前缀法则如果索引了多列(联合索引),要遵守最左前缀法则。最左前缀法则指的是查询从索引的最左列开始,并且不跳过索引中的列。如果跳跃某一列,索引将会部分失效(后面的字段索引失效)。以tb_user表为例,我们先来查看一下之前tb_user表所创建的索引。在......
  • 《MySQL与MariaDB学习指南》高清高质量 原版电子书PDF+源码
    下载:https://pan.quark.cn/s/2392eb287424......
  • mysql 创建表分区 list分区
    CREATETABLE`goods`(`id`varchar(36)NOTNULL,`goods_name`varchar(256)NOTNULLCOMMENT'产品名称',`release_version`varchar(8)NOTNULL,PRIMARYKEY(`release_version`,`id`))ENGINE=InnoDBDEFAULTCHARSET=utf8mb4ROW_FORMAT=DYNAMIC;al......
  • Windows安装MySQL
    一、下载安装包1、下载地址:https://downloads.mysql.com/archives/community/二、解压并创建配置文件,创建数据目录1、步骤#1将下载的压缩包解压#2在bin目录同级下创建一个文件,命名为my.ini#3在bin目录同级下创建一个文件夹,命名为data三、编辑配置文件my.in......
  • clickhouse连接访问mysql
    创建MySQL表创建数据库test和表t1,并向t1表中插入几条数据CREATEdatabasetest;usetest;CREATEtablet1(idint,namevarchar(100));INSERTINTOt1values(1,'a'),(2,'b'),(3,'c');SELECT*FROMt1;ClickHouse连接访问MySQL方式1:数据库引擎MySQL用......
  • P9474 [yLOI2022] 长安幻世绘
    题目意思:需要在元素互不相同的数列\(a\)中选出一个长度为\(m\)的元素互不相邻的子列,使得子列的极差最小。做法我们知道,对于一组数列,我们只需知道它的最大值和最小值,就可以得到它的极差。那么我们可以将数字从小到大排序,固定最小值,寻找最优的最大值,当最小值和最大值的位置固......
  • Typecho博客网站迁移:MySQL ➡️ MarialDB
    目录1.引言2.Typecho的自定义配置迁移3.数据库迁移:MySQL->MarialDB3.1在原服务器中备份并导出数据库文件3.2将“backupdb.sql”文件拷贝至新服务器并导入数据4.Nginx配置5.Handsome主题操作1.引言由于服务、价格等因素更换云服务器是很常见的情况,本文记录了Typecho博......
  • MySQL数据库被锁表你有遇到过吗?
    1.被锁原因1、锁表发生在insertupdate、delete中;2、锁表的原理是数据库使用独占式封锁机制,当执行上面的语句时,对表进行锁住,直到发生commite或者回滚或者退出数据库用户;3、锁表的原因:3.1、A程序执行了对tableA的insert,并还未commite时,B程序也对tableA进行insert......